meh:
"Given the Reference 110's dual-mono construction, with each channel's audio circuitry carried on its own board, I was surprised to find that the channel separation at 1kHz was 85dB (L–R) and 96dB (R–L), decreasing by another 10dB at 50kHz.
The wideband, unweighted signal/noise ratio (ref. 2.83V into 8 ohms, 8 ohm tap) was good rather than great at 79.5dB... noise at the frequency extremes that is affecting the unweighted result."
all this for $10K

i thought all lower end/ lower cost powered monitors will have a high noise floor
If you turn the any amp up all the way with a low input signal you'll always have a lot of distortion. I think that's a mistake people make with monitors, they turn them up all the way then feed a low signal into them. It's better to have monitors turned down to half or less volume with a strong input signal to the monitors.
